What is Minimalist Interior Design?

Minimalist interior design is defined by its emphasis on simplicity, functionality, and clarity, stripping back to essential qualities and embodying a less-is-more philosophy. This approach is not just about achieving a clean look; it's a lifestyle choice that promotes a clutter-free and tranquil environment. 

In HDB homes, adopting a minimalist design can greatly enhance the perception of space, making rooms appear larger and more open, while reducing visual clutter, which contributes to a more calming atmosphere. These benefits make minimalist design a powerful tool for transforming living spaces into calm havens.

Decluttering Strategies

Decluttering is basic to achieving minimalism, emphasising the importance of quality over quantity. To effectively declutter, it’s crucial to regularly evaluate each item in your home, considering its practicality and emotional value. Integrating smart storage solutions, such as multipurpose cabinets, helps maintain an organised space by keeping essentials neatly stored yet accessible. 

Moreover, cultivating habits that prevent clutter accumulation is essential for sustaining a pristine living environment. These strategies not only clear physical space but also promote a more focused and serene lifestyle, essential for a minimalist home.

Choosing the Right Furniture

Furniture in a minimalist HDB home should prioritise functionality, simplicity, and aesthetics. Select pieces that not only serve a practical purpose but also contribute to the clean, uncluttered feel of the room. For example:

  • A minimalist sofa can anchor the living space gracefully, providing comfort without cluttering the area.
  • A round coffee table can be both decorative and functional, offering utility without taking up excessive space.
  • Opt for furniture that embodies clean lines and a neutral colour palette, enhancing the sense of space and seamlessly blending with the overall decor.

Embracing a Neutral Colour Palette

Adopting a neutral colour palette can also achieve the serene and spacious feel of minimalist interior design. Starting with a base of whites, greys, or beiges enhances the perception of space and sets a tranquil tone for the home. These foundational colours can be subtly enriched with accents in soft hues, which add depth and interest without overwhelming the senses.

To prevent the space from feeling too stark or bland, integrate a variety of textures through fabrics and materials. This can include soft throws, textured rugs, or wood grains, which add warmth and visual interest while maintaining the minimalist vibe. Such thoughtful touches ensure the environment remains engaging and welcoming.

Incorporating Minimalist Decor Elements

When incorporating minimalist decor, it's essential to maintain a balance and ensure each element serves a purpose without overwhelming the space:

  • Artwork: Opt for minimalist artwork that complements rather than dominates, such as simple line drawings or understated abstracts that meld with your colour scheme.
  • Lighting: Choose sleek, functional lighting fixtures that sweeten the mood and the minimalist aesthetic. Look for designs that integrate smoothly into the space.
  • Textiles: Select textiles like curtains and cushions that provide comfort and add subtle texture, sticking to a neutral palette that reinforces the minimalist feel.
